Key Ingredients for Apple Date Cake

Dates: Pitted and chopped dates are a crucial ingredient in apple date cake, bringing natural sweetness and moisture to the mix. Their rich, caramel-like flavor pairs beautifully with the tartness of apples, creating a harmonious balance in each slice.

Apple Juice: I like to use apple juice in this recipe to infuse an additional layer of fruity flavor, enhancing the overall taste. If you’re ever in a pinch, don’t hesitate to substitute with plain water.

Baking Soda: This little powerhouse elevates the cake, ensuring it rises perfectly and delivers that light, fluffy texture we all adore.

All-Purpose Flour: The backbone of this dessert, all-purpose flour provides the necessary structure, making it easy to slice and serve.

Apples: Opt for crisp apples like Granny Smith or Honeycrisp, diced small to add both tartness and delightful crunch.

Butter: Utilizing softened butter in the batter keeps the cake rich and moist, elevating each bite to a new level of deliciousness.

Brown Sugar: This ingredient is essential, bringing not just sweetness but also a warm aroma and beautiful color to the cake.

Eggs: Two large eggs bind all the ingredients, ensuring that the cake maintains its shape without sacrificing moisture.

Vanilla Extract: A hint of vanilla enhances the flavor profile, bringing everything together seamlessly.

Powdered Sugar: For the glaze, powdered sugar adds a sweet and elegant finish, tying this delicious apple date cake together perfectly.

Can I substitute other fruits in this cake?

Absolutely! While apples and dates create a harmonious blend in this apple date cake, you can experiment with other fruits. Pears, for example, would add a similar sweet and juicy profile. Dried fruits like figs or raisins can also work well, contributing to the cake’s texture and flavor. Just remember to adjust the sweetness accordingly if you choose a sweeter fruit!

Is this cake suitable for freezing?

Yes! If you find yourself with leftover apple date cake, freezing it is a great option. Be sure to let the cake cool completely, then wrap it tightly in plastic wrap followed by aluminum foil to prevent freezer burn. It should retain its flavor and texture for up to three months. When you’re ready to enjoy it again, simply thaw it in the refrigerator overnight.

How can I make the cake more moist?

To enhance the moistness of your apple date cake, consider adding a splash of apple juice or an extra tablespoon of yogurt to the batter. You could also incorporate a bit of oil in place of some butter, which can help keep the cake tender and moist. Lastly, ensuring not to overbake it is key—removing the cake when a toothpick comes out with a few moist crumbs will yield the best results.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ups dates (pitted and chopped, 280 grams)
  • 1 ½ cups apple juice (or water, 360 grams)
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 ¾ cups all-purpose flour (210 grams)
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• ½ te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• 12 tablespoons butter (softened, ¾ cup; 170 grams)
  • ¾ cup brown sugar (150 grams)
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 2 to 3 apples (peeled and diced, 2 ½ cups)
  • ¾ cup powdered sugar (90 grams)
  • 1 ½ to 2 ½ tablespoons milk
  • ½ te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Pre-heat the oven to 350°F. Grease a 9-inch square pan (or a 10-inch round pan) and line it with parchment paper.
  2. Prep the dates: Place the chopped dates, apple juice (or water), and baking soda in a saucepan. The mixture will foam as the baking soda reacts and the dates begin to break down. Bring it to a boil, then turn off the heat and let it sit for 20 to 30 minutes to cool and fully soften.
  3. Mix the dry ingredients: In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, salt, cinnamon, and nutmeg.
  4. Cream the butter and sugar: Beat the softened butter and brown sugar until creamy. Add the eggs one at a time, then mix in the vanilla.
  5. Add the date mixture: Pour the softened dates (along with all the liquid) into the batter and mix until combined.
  6. Add the apples and dry ingredients: Stir in the apples then fold in the dry ingredients just until incorporated.
  7. Bake: Spread the batter into the pan and bake at 350°F for 40–48 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  8. Glaze the cake: In a small bowl, whisk together the powdered sugar, 1 tablespoon of milk, and the vanilla until smooth. Add additional milk until the glaze reaches a thick but pourable consistency.
  9. Drizzle the glaze over the cooled cake, or use a spoon to spread it lightly over the top. Allow the glaze to set before slicing.
